ArangoDB的图遍历策略是可靠的,它提供了多种图遍历算法,并支持深度优先搜索(DFS)和广度优先搜索(BFS),以及加权的图遍历等功能,能够满足不同场景下的图数据查询需求。以下是关于ArangoDB图遍历策略的详细信息:
ArangoDB图遍历策略的可靠性
- 图遍历算法:ArangoDB支持深度优先搜索(DFS)和广度优先搜索(BFS),允许用户根据具体需求选择合适的遍历方式。
- 加权的图遍历:ArangoDB 3.8版本引入了加权的图遍历功能,通过增加权重来枚举路径,提供了更灵活的图查询选项。
ArangoDB图遍历的性能优化
- ArangoDB 3.11版本的新功能:ArangoDB 3.11版本通过引入新的列缓存选项和优化内存中边索引的使用,提升了图遍历的性能。
- 性能提升对图遍历的影响:这些性能改进使得ArangoDB能够更高效地处理复杂的图查询,减少了查询响应时间,提高了用户体验。
ArangoDB图遍历的实际应用案例
- 社交网络分析:ArangoDB的图遍历功能可以用于分析社交网络中的关系,如朋友关系、粉丝关系等,帮助用户理解社交网络的结构和动态。
- 推荐系统:通过图遍历,ArangoDB可以分析用户的行为和偏好,为用户提供个性化的推荐。
综上所述,ArangoDB的图遍历策略是可靠的,它不仅提供了多种图遍历算法,还通过不断的技术改进来优化图遍历性能,适用于各种需要处理图数据的场景。